Role Description This is a part time, work from home Video Editor role based in Guwahati. The Video Editor will assemble, edit, and refine video content for brand campaigns, social media, and cinematic projects, ensuring alignment with each brand’s narrative and visual identity. Responsibilities include organizing raw footage, selecting key shots, applying transitions, color grading, adding graphics or motion elements, and preparing final exports for different platforms. The role also involves collaborating with directors, producers, and creative strategists, interpreting briefs, and contributing ideas to enhance storytelling. The Video Editor will manage timelines, maintain project files, and ensure consistent quality across all video outputs.
